Este fichero de configuración tiene las siguientes secciones:
[Standard Form]
Esta entrada registra todos los Forms simples de mantenimiento para
cada una de las tablas del repositorio. Ejemplo:
Pequeño Menu=MnSmall,temp_mn,FStdAbs,templinc
[Head-Lines Form]
Esta entrada registra todos los Forms de cabeceras-líneas para
dos tablas del repositorio. No es necesario que las tablas tengan alguna
dependencia o relación (join) entre ellas. Ejemplo:
(1)Cabecera-Lineas=FrmHeadLines,tmpfom,FStdAbs,templinc
[Simple Report]
Esta entrada registra todas las clases «Page» que permiten
hacer un listado de tipo ficha o etiqueta de una tabla del repositorio.
Ejemplo:
Etiquetas=MailLabels,template,absPage,templinc,maillab
[Standard Report]
Esta entrada registra todas las clases «Page» que permiten
hacer un listado de tipo líneas de una tabla del repositorio.
Ejemplo:
Listado standard=StandardPage,template,stdPage,templinc
[Mail Labels]
Esta entrada registra todas las clases «Page» que permiten
hacer un listado de tipo carta de una tabla del repositorio. Ejemplo:
Etiquetas=MailLabels,template,absPage,templinc
[Head-Lines Report]
Esta entrada registra todas las clases «Page» que permiten
hacer un listado de cabeceras-líneas de dos tablas del repositorio
que tengan alguna dependencia o relación (join) entre ellas.
Ejemplo:
Cabecera-Lineas=HeadLinesPage,template, absHLPage,templinc
IMPORTANTE
No se pueden añadir nuevas secciones. Sólo se pueden añadir
entradas a las secciones existentes.
Las secciones de este fichero tienen el siguiente formato:
Nombre_sección = nombre_clase, nombre_módulo, clase_padre, nombre_módulo_clase_padre
Donde:
Ejemplo de fichero «TEMPLATE.INI»:
[Standard Form]
Simple= SmallForm,template
Mediano=MediumForm,template
(1)Pequeño=FrmSmall,tmpfom,FStdAbs,templinc
(2)Pequeño=FSmall,tmpvide,FStdAbs,templinc
(3)Pequeño=ConSmall,temp_con,FStdAbs,templinc
(4)Pequeño=BtnSmall,temp_btn,FStdAbs,templinc
Pequeño Menu=MnSmall,temp_mn,FStdAbs,templinc
(1)Pequeño Edit=FrmSmallEd,tmpfom,FStdAbsEd,templinc
(2)Pequeño Edit=FSmallEdit,tmpvide,FStdAbsEd,templinc
(3)Pequeño Edit=ConSmallEd,temp_con,FStdAbsEd,templinc
(4)Pequeño Edit=BtnSmallEd,temp_btn,FStdAbsEd,templinc
Pequeño Menu Edit=MnSmallEd,temp_mn,FStdAbsEd,templinc
Ficha Grande=LargeForm,template
(1)Ficha=FrmTab,tmpfom,FStdAbs,templinc
(2)Ficha=FTab,tmpvide,FStdAbs,templinc
(3)Ficha=ConTab,temp_con,FStdAbs,templinc
(4)Ficha=BtnTab,temp_btn,FStdAbs,templinc
Ficha Menu=MnTab,temp_mn,FStdAbs,templinc
(1)Ficha Edit=FrmTabEd,tmpfom,FStdAbsEd,templinc
(2)Ficha Edit=FTabEdit,tmpvide,FStdAbsEd,templinc
(3)Ficha Edit=ConTabEd,temp_con,FStdAbsEd,templinc
(4)Ficha Edit=BtnTabEd,temp_btn,FStdAbsEd,templinc
Ficha Menu Edit=MnTabEd,temp_mn,FStdAbsEd,templinc
Lineas=LinesForm,template
(1)Lineas pequeño=FrmSmaLines,tmpfom,FStdAbs,templinc
(2)Lineas pequeño=FSmallLines,tmpvide,FStdAbs,templinc
(3)Lineas pequeño=ConSmaLines,temp_con,FStdAbs,templinc
(4)Lineas pequeño=BtnSmallLin,temp_btn,FStdAbs,templinc
(5)Lineas pequeño=SmallLinesForm,template
Lin. pequeño Menu=MnSmallLin,temp_mn,FStdAbs,templinc
(1)Lin pq Edit=FrmSmaLinEd,tmpfom,FStdAbsEd,templinc
(2)Lin pq Edit=FSmallEdit,tmpvide,FStdAbsEd,templinc
(3)Lin pq Edit=ConSmLinEd,temp_con,FStdAbsEd,templinc
(4)Lin pq Edit=BtnSmLinEd,temp_btn,FStdAbsEd,templinc
Lin. pq. Menu Edit=MnSmLinEd,temp_mn,FStdAbsEd,templinc
Pequeño lineas Edit=FSmLinEdit,tmpvide,FStdAbsEd,templinc
(1)Medio=FrmMedium,tmpfom,FStdAbs,templinc
(2)Medio=FMed,tmpvide,FStdAbs,templinc
(3)Medio=ConMedium,temp_con,FStdAbs,templinc
(4)Medio=BtnMed,temp_btn,FStdAbs,templinc
Medio Menu=MnMedium,temp_mn,FStdAbs,templinc
(1)Medio Edit=FrmMedEd,tmpfom,FStdAbsEd,templinc
(2)Medio Edit=FMedEdit,tmpvide,FStdAbsEd,templinc
(3)Medio Edit=ConMedEd,temp_con,FStdAbsEd,templinc
(4)Medio Edit=BtnMedEd,temp_btn,FStdAbsEd,templinc
Medio Menu Edit=MnMedium,temp_mn,FStdAbsEd,templinc
(1)Lin Medio=FrmMedLines,tmpfom,FStdAbs,templinc
(2)Lin Medio=FMedLines,tmpvide,FStdAbs,templinc
(3)Lin Medio=ConMedium,temp_con,FStdAbs,templinc
(4)Lin Medio=BtnMedLines,temp_btn,FStdAbs,templinc
Lin Medio Menu=MnMedLines,temp_mn,FStdAbs,templinc
(1)Lin Medio Edit=FrmMedLinEd,tmpfom,FStdAbsEd,templinc
(2)Lin Medio Edit=FMedLinEd,tmpvide,FStdAbsEd,templinc
(3)Lin Medio Edit=ConMedLinEd,temp_con,FStdAbsEd,templinc
(4)Lin Medio Edit=BtnMedLinEd,temp_btn,FStdAbsEd,templinc
Lin Medio Menu Edit=MnMedLinEd,temp_mn,FStdAbsEd,templinc
[Head-Lines Form]
Cabecera-Lineas=HeadLinesForm,template
(1)Cabecera-Lineas=FrmHeadLines,tmpfom,FStdAbs,templinc
(2)Cabecera-Lineas=FCabLin,tmpvide,FStdAbs,templinc
(3)Cabecera-Lineas=ConHeadLines,temp_con,FStdAbs,templinc
(4)Cabecera-Lineas=BtnCabLin,temp_btn,FStdAbs,templinc
Cab-Lin Menu=MnCabLin,temp_mn,FStdAbs,templinc
(1)Cab-Lin Edit=FrmHeadLinesEd,tmpfom,FStdAbsEd,templinc
(2)Cab-Lin Edit=FCabLinEd,tmpvide,FStdAbsEd,templinc
(3)Cab-Lin Edit=ConHeadLinEd,temp_con,FStdAbsEd,templinc
(4)Cab-Lin Edit=BtnCabLinEd,temp_btn,FStdAbsEd,templinc
Cab-Lin Menu Edit=MnCabLinEd,temp_mn,FStdAbsEd,templinc
[Simple Report]
Listado de lineas=LinesPage,template,absPage,templinc,listing
Ficha=CardPage,template,simplePage,templinc,card
Etiquetas=MailLabels,template,absPage,templinc,maillab
[Standard Report]
Listado standard=StandardPage,template,stdPage,templinc
[Mail Labels]
Etiquetas=MailLabels,template,absPage,templinc
[Head-Lines Report]
Cabecera-Lineas=HeadLinesPage,template,absHLPage,templinc